Jayson Tatum Pays Tribute to Kobe Bryant with Lakers-Celtics Christmas Day Performance

That in a Los Angeles Lakers-Boston Celtics, eternal NBA classic, and on the Lakers court – now Crypto.com Arena for advertising reasons – a player dressed in the ‘sacred green tunic’ of Boston wears, at the same time , purple details would practically constitute a reason for war. Even more so if this were the 70s-80s-90s, then what Jayson Tatum did in the eternal duel on the occasion of Christmas Day (115-126) it was a tribute and a show of respect. From the current ‘proud greens’ reference to the modern gold and purple myth, Kobe Bryant.

Tatum, before Davis.

It is not the first time that Tatum pays tribute to his idol. He always considered him as his reference and even in terms of playing style there are similarities between the two. Style, shooting range and scoring ability. Since the tragic death of the ‘Black Mamba’, ‘JT’ remembers him. He used the purple armband like Kobe’s and repeated in what was in 2022 the “biggest game of his career”, as he explained.

It was the seventh game between the Boston Celtics and Miami Heat of the 2022 Eastern finals. Boston won the conference and would play the finals against the Golden State Warriors. Tatum was MVP wearing that purple armband. He did not stop there, because he taught as he had written before starting in the chat he had with Kobe. “You’re with me,” she left him.

Jayson Tatum

A way to remember the reference and idol of many in the NBA. “I was watching some moments of his career. This is the most important game of my career so far and I wanted to use that detail to honor him and share that moment,” he reflected.

Tatum established himself as a star of the League and in his most special Classic, on Christmas Day, he repeated the tribute. Against the Lakers and in Los Angeles. He won the game, with 25 points, 8 rebounds and 7 assists as a statistical line and keeping Boston in command of the regular season.
